Teens Expose Themselves Online
The Sydney Morning Herald -- Mar 13 -- "paradelinks the intimacies of their lives for everyone except those who, on a day-to-day basis at least, live closest to them and have known them longest"...

"they're doing exactly what we did at their age, even if we did it through physical space..."

I love those quotes, written by Anne Karpf. It's so true that kids these days are doing the same things their parents did when they were that age (not a big relief to some of us). They are just doing their thing in a different way, and maybe it's a little more public.

Instead of writing in their diaries and giggling with their friends they are writing everything in their public blog for the whole world to see. Instead of bringing their photos to school to show to their friends they are posting them on their Web sites. Instead of "hanging out" at the local store after school they're "hanging out" online with their friends.

It's not really too much different it's just done in a different way.
